What is the % (w/v) concentration of a solution containing 12 grams of solute in 400 ml of solution?

Respuesta :

kenmyna
kenmyna kenmyna
  • 01-04-2018
weight/volume  percentage  =  mass of  the  solute/volume  of  solution  x    100

mass of  the   solute=  12grams
volume  of  solution  =  400ml
therefore  %  (w/v)  =  12 /  400  x100  =  3%
